Handpull at the King's Head, Leicester. Bright gold and clear with a little ring of white head. Odd aroma. Aroma of apple skin, linen, vegetal notes. Decent taste, not too sweet. Nor a lot of apple either. A bit chemical. Medium body and carbonation. Not great, but certainly drinkable.

On tap at Hops, Crewe. Pours a bright apricot with no head at all. As expected apples mainly in the aroma, with just a hint of oranges. Apples again in the mouth, with a watery texture. But it does become quite dry with peel and some underlying sweetness. Quite light and juicy. Not bad – at least not sickly sweet.

Cask at Ye Olde Red Horse, Evesham, 06/09/22. Pale yellow to light yellow with little in the way of a head. Nose is mellow apple, orchard wood, straw, apple core, dusty orchard. Taste comprises apple pulp, tannins, apple skins, light sugar. Medium bodied, moderate carbonation, light drying close. Not bad.

Draught at ORB micropub, Darlington. Orange gold colour, no head and oily barnyard aroma. Taste is fruity apple, juicy , bittersweet with some woody funk and tannin. Medium bodied, low carbonation, dry lightly tannic finish. Nicely drinkable.
